Here is a list of tactics in order to attract guests and tenants to short term rental
c
At first, it’s important to recognize your target market: to create marketing messages that resonate with your target audience and customize your offerings to suit their needs, you must have a thorough understanding of this group.
To determine the tastes, habits, and passions of your ideal clients whether they are families, business travelers, vacationers, or members of other niche markets conduct market research.

Then, invest in high-end filmmaking and photography: visuals of the highest caliber are crucial to drawing in prospective visitors and emphasizing the special qualities of your rental home.
Employ a skilled photographer and filmmaker to produce eye-catching pictures and videos that showcase the features, surroundings, and décor of the property.

Besides, it’s important to enhance your listing on platforms for short-term rentals: make use of the resources and features offered by well-known websites for short-term rentals, like Booking.com, Airbnb, and Vrbo.
Compose engaging property descriptions that stress the special advantages of staying at your rental and highlight the main selling points.
To increase search visibility and draw in visitors who are actively looking for lodging in your area, use pertinent keywords and phrases.
But also, employ social media promotion: use social media sites like Facebook, Instagram, and Twitter to interact with prospective visitors and promote your vacation rental.

Post engrossing images, videos, and narratives to entice followers to make reservations by providing a peek into the guest experience.
Launch specialized advertising campaigns to advertise discounts or special offers to particular demographics.
Then provide discounts and incentives: to encourage reservations, entice potential guests with exclusive offers, rebates, or promotional packages.
Think about providing benefits like early bird discounts, last-minute offers, freebies, or subsidized rates for longer stays.
After that, promote favorable testimonials and reviews: the decision-making process of prospective guests can be greatly influenced by positive reviews and testimonials.

To guarantee a memorable stay, offer first-rate amenities and service. Satisfied customers are more likely to write positive reviews and comments on your listing.
It’s important to do collaborations and partnerships: work together to establish advantageous alliances with nearby companies, tourist destinations, and event planners.
To improve the overall visitor experience and draw in more reservations, collaborate with local eateries, tour companies, or entertainment venues to offer special discounts or packages.
